8. Course Plan

Week Lecture
1 Course introduction
2 Introduction to product design & development; Product dvelopment processes & organizations
3 Customer needs identification
4 Product specifications
5 Patent survey & analysis
6 Concept generation
7 Concept selection; Concept testing
8 Midterm
9 Product architecture
10 Prototyping
11 Design for manufacturing; Industrial & ergonomic design
12 Product development processes & organizations
13 Product planning
14 Product development economics; Project management
15 Robust design
16 Final
